More about the book

Why did Marks and Spencer, once Britain’s most admired retailers and most successful business, collapse so precipitously, and how long will its recent recovery last for? All is revealed in a fully updated version of this detailed history of the rise and fall of one of Great Britain's most lucrative household names.
